Meanwhile, Dogra brings a <strong>teacher-mentor business model<\/strong> grounded in India\u2019s spiritual traditions, offering customized guidance through astrology, numerology, and healing.<\/p>\n<p>Both entrepreneurs exemplify how digital tools can expand spiritual practices into sustainable global ecosystems, while staying aligned with the ethics of energy exchange and authenticity.<\/p>\n<div>\n<hr \/>\n<\/div>\n<h2>Chris Corsini\u2019s Business Model \u2014 Accessibility, Inclusivity, and Artistic Monetization<\/h2>\n<p>Chris Corsini has become one of the world\u2019s most influential Tarot and astrology creators by building a <strong>donation-based, inclusive, and multimedia-driven business model<\/strong>. His signature style mixes astrology insights, sign language accessibility, and visually artistic content\u2014creating an inclusive digital sanctuary for people seeking guidance.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/i1.feedspot.com\/original\/7262494.jpg\" alt=\"Jyoti Dogra chris\" width=\"720\" height=\"720\" \/><\/p>\n<p>Corsini operates across multiple platforms\u2014YouTube, Instagram, Patreon, and digital workshops\u2014allowing him to reach diverse audiences without gatekeeping access to spiritual tools. His videos and readings are <strong>free to watch<\/strong>, with optional donations through Patreon or PayPal. This accessibility fuels community loyalty and brand trust, which in turn sustains his business.<\/p>\n<p>Corsini\u2019s model thrives on the principle that spirituality should be <strong>available to everyone<\/strong>, and monetization should flow organically from appreciation and energy exchange\u2014not obligation. His inclusive approach, combined with an aesthetic rooted in creativity and compassion, gives his business global appeal.<\/p>\n<h3>Monetization Channels of Chris Corsini<\/h3>\n<ol start=\"1\" data-spread=\"true\">\n<li><strong>Patreon and donation-based revenue:<\/strong> Corsini\u2019s Patreon tiers offer early access to readings, exclusive workshops, and community support spaces. The optional nature of payment empowers followers to give according to their means, creating an ethical and sustainable monetization loop.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Digital product sales:<\/strong> He offers pre-recorded workshops, astrology and energy reports, and eBooks. These products allow him to scale income while maintaining value-based pricing.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Brand collaborations and live events:<\/strong> Corsini partners with wellness and lifestyle brands for aligned campaigns, and hosts events combining art, music, and spirituality\u2014transforming Tarot into a cultural experience.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Merchandise and limited-edition drops:<\/strong> His artistic background translates into unique merchandise collections that reinforce brand identity and offer an additional revenue stream.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>Corsini\u2019s business thrives because of his authenticity. His followers feel they are part of a movement\u2014not just an audience\u2014making his brand both emotionally and economically resilient.<\/p>\n<div>\n<hr \/>\n<\/div>\n<h2>Jyoti Dogra\u2019s Business Model \u2014 Traditional Wisdom Meets Digital Entrepreneurship<\/h2>\n<p>In contrast, <strong>Jyoti Dogra<\/strong> represents a deeply rooted Indian model of spiritual entrepreneurship\u2014where ancient wisdom meets digital precision. Blending <strong>Tarot, Vedic astrology, numerology, and energy healing<\/strong>, her brand speaks to both tradition and transformation.<\/p>\n<p>Dogra has leveraged Instagram Reels, YouTube videos, and personalized consultation sessions to build her business. Her strength lies in combining <strong>one-on-one mentorship<\/strong> with <strong>educational offerings<\/strong>, appealing to a generation that seeks both insight and empowerment. Rather than relying on donations, Dogra\u2019s business is <strong>service-based<\/strong>, focusing on personalized sessions, reports, and premium guidance.<\/p>\n<p>This model reflects the cultural roots of Indian spirituality, where knowledge and mentorship form the foundation of exchange. Her sessions often include tailored guidance, long-term spiritual roadmaps, and healing practices\u2014creating deep, loyal client relationships.<\/p>\n<h3>Monetization Channels of Jyoti Dogra<\/h3>\n<ol start=\"1\" data-spread=\"true\">\n<li><strong>Paid consultations:<\/strong> Dogra offers personalized Tarot and astrology sessions for clients across India and abroad, often bundled into relationship, career, or spiritual packages.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Workshops and mentorship programs:<\/strong> She runs online batches teaching Tarot, manifestation, and healing techniques. These programs create recurring income while positioning her as an expert mentor.<\/li>\n<li><strong>YouTube and social media monetization:<\/strong> Through regular uploads and reels, Dogra drives discovery and generates ad revenue while promoting her services organically.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Brand appearances and collaborations:<\/strong> Occasionally, Dogra engages in collaborations with wellness or lifestyle brands aligned with her spiritual philosophy.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>Dogra\u2019s business is built around <strong>personal trust, transformation stories, and authority in Indian mysticism<\/strong>. Her strength lies in offering a structured, premium spiritual service that blends modern marketing with age-old wisdom.<\/p>\n<div>\n<hr \/>\n<\/div>\n<h2>East vs. West \u2014 How Their Business Philosophies Reflect Cultural Mindsets<\/h2>\n<p>Chris Corsini and Jyoti Dogra embody two distinct spiritual business philosophies rooted in their cultural ecosystems.
